From: Fred Drake Date: Thu, 30 Aug 2001 18:53:25 +0000 (+0000) Subject: When re-writing a factor containing a unary negation of a literal, only X-Git-Tag: v2.2a3~199 X-Git-Url: http://git.ipfire.org/gitweb.cgi?a=commitdiff_plain;h=14ef244dfe8b79694d4baa48ceda874fe27ec05d;p=thirdparty%2FPython%2Fcpython.git When re-writing a factor containing a unary negation of a literal, only affect nodes without another operator. This was causing negated exponentiations to drop the exponentiation.
